Sales

      At Professional Hospitality, we know that the best way to drive hotel revenue and increase market share is through sales. Professional Hospitality supervises the property sales staff under the direction of our Corporate Director of Sales. Having dedicated sales staff is vital to bringing new business to our hotels, and also means that our General Managers can spend their time making sure that the hotel they manage performs to the highest standards.

The direct benefits of a property sales person are:
  • Timely follow-up to all sales leads generated from the Chamber of Commerce, Convention and Visitors Bureau and other sources.
  • Establishment of relationships and acquisition of new corporate accounts.
  • Using specialized sales software, the sales staff enter all contacts, appointments, and acquired business giving the Corporate Director of Sales an efficient way to monitor their efforts.
  • Provides the property with an effective link to the community by keeping them on people's minds whenever they have lodging needs.
  • Attends trade shows, Chamber of Commerce events, Convention & Visitor's Bureau events and area business meetings.

      The responsibilities of our sales people are further enhanced by our Corporate Director of Sales and the support they provide to the property staff. The Director of Sale's primary focus is to assist the property sales people in name awareness and generating new business.

The responsibilities of the Corporate Director of Sales includes:
  • Assists with training and follow-up of all sales people upon hire.
  • Frequently contacts sales staff to ensure that they are making the most of every interaction.
  • Assists with the planning and organization of area sales blitzes. This is an effective way to increase market share and generate leads.
  • Conducts quarterly property visits to evaluate the sales staff and establish future goals; ensuring we have the best team for increasing our business.
  • Semi-annually meets with all property sales staff allowing them to exchange ideas and work together to improve on their sales skills and learn from their peers.

SIGNATURE TRAINING
      The Corporate Director of Sales also manages the Signature front desk training program. This program supplies daily sales training to the front desk staff. The system teaches the front desk staff how to up-sell customers and increase the daily revenue, while ensuring that no opportunities are missed. The dedicated sales staff is focused on new accounts; however, the front desk staff is the most critical sales team for any hotel. This is where the purchase is made and additional revenue can be captured.
